Job Summary
The Production Scheduler manages the daily operations schedule for the paint line departments, orders paint and chemicals to ensure on‑time delivery, productivity, and quality, and collaborates with supervisors and the leadership team to track progress, allocate resources, and resolve scheduling conflicts.

Responsibilities

Develop and maintain detailed production schedules, including timelines, milestones, and deliverables.

Prepare plans and schedules to support complex operational needs.

Coordinate with the paint department and cross‑functional team members to align schedules with production requirements.

Order and manage paint and chemical inventory to support production demands and meet customer delivery requirements.

Complete daily reporting on paint conditions, resource planning, staffing, late orders, and system health, ensuring routing information is accurately updated.

Provide feedback to leadership on staffing levels and material availability to help prioritize work effectively.

Schedule orders to meet process start dates and support on‑time delivery goals, ensuring alignment across all schedules on daily priorities and staffing plans.

Monitor and adjust schedules to ensure timely completion of production targets.

Communicate delays to leadership for review and proactively manage scheduling conflicts.

Keep stakeholders informed of schedule changes and use scheduling tools to track performance, timeliness, and resource allocation.

Prepare regular reports on schedule adherence and performance for management.

Support the development and implementation of scheduling and project‑management best practices.
